Brentford’s head coach, Keith Andrews, held a press conference ahead of the English Championship match against Liverpool, where he answered questions about his team’s lineup. One of the questions concerned the Ukrainian midfielder Yehor Yarmolyuk.
Keith Andrews and Yehor Yarmolyuk. Photo: brentfordfc.com“Yehor’s role has grown. He finished last season very well, and this is his first full season as a starting player. He has taken this opportunity, and I believe his performances have been truly outstanding.
His authority on the field has grown, and he really understands the game. I planned for him to become an important part of the team. For this, you need to show excellent play. It’s good that I have ideas, but they need to be implemented, and I think we saw that practically right away during the preseason preparations.
He strives to develop his game, eager to learn more about actions in midfield and what is necessary for that. He is in the right environment to continue his development,” quotes Andrews' words on Brentford’s website.
